Here’s the recipe for those who want it 1 cup bread flour (120 grams) 3/4 cup Plain flour (90 grams) 2 tsp salt 1 tsp baking soda 225g butter (1 cup) 2 tbsp water 1 cup brown sugar (213 grams) 1/2 cup white sugar (granulated) (100 grams) 2 tsp vanilla extract 1 tsp espresso powder 1 egg & 1 egg yolk Chocolate chips and chunks Method: 1. Sift flours, salt and baking soda. Set aside 2. In saucepan, melt butter and brown it. Stir constantly until it becomes a nutty brown colour and foamy 3. Allow to cool in a jug then add water to bring the measurement back to 1 cup 4. Cream sugars, vanilla, espresso powder and cooled butter 5. Add egg and egg yolk. Add it dry ingredients half at a time then mix 6. Fold in choc chips and scoop onto trays lined with parchment paper 7. Refrigerate for an hour and preheat oven to 350 f (180c) 8. Bake for 12-14 mins. Let cool then transfer to cooling rack Enjoy 😊

@@nisatanrkulu207 1 cup bread flour ¾ cup all-purpose flour 2 teaspoons kosher salt, or 1½ teaspoons table salt 1 teaspoon baking soda 1 cup unsalted butter, 2 sticks 2 tablespoons water, room temperature 1 cup dark brown sugar ½ cup white sugar 2 teaspoons vanilla extract 1 teaspoon espresso powder 1 large egg 1 large egg yolk ½ cup semi-sweet chocolate chips 5 oz dark chocolate, chopped In a medium bowl, sift together the flours, salt, and baking soda. Set aside. In a medium or large saucepan, add the butter and melt over medium heat. The larger the pan you use, the quicker the process will be! Bring the butter to a boil, stirring frequently. As the water begins to boil out of the butter, the milk solids in the butter will separate, sink to the bottom, and begin to toast and brown. As this begins to happen, make sure to stir constantly so the butter browns evenly. It may become quite foamy, splatter a bit, and be difficult to see, so keep a close eye on it, removing from heat and continuing to stir if it starts to foam over. Once the butter has turned a nice nutty brown, remove from the heat and pour into a large liquid measuring cup to stop the cooking. Allow it to cool down for a minute or two, give it a stir, and carefully add 2-3 tablespoons of water to the butter to bring it back up to 1 cup (240 ml) of liquid. Set aside to cool to room temperature. To help speed this process up, you can place in the fridge for 10-15 minutes. You want to make sure the butter is still liquid when you’re adding it to the dough later on, so make sure to remove after 15 minutes. In a large bowl, add the sugars, vanilla, espresso powder, and cooled brown butter. Cream together with an electric hand mixer until light and fluffy, 1-2 minutes. Add the egg and yolk and beat until incorporated. Add the dry ingredients, about ⅓ of the mixture at a time, and beat between additions until just incorporated. It’s okay for there to be a bit of unmixed flour on the edge of bowl, this will be incorporated in the next step. Using a wooden spoon, fold the chocolate chips and chunks into the dough Scoop the cookies onto a parchment paper-lined baking sheet in 3-tablespoon-sized mounds. For optimal flavor, cover and refrigerate for 1 hour or, even better, overnight. Preheat the oven to 350˚F (180˚C). Evenly space the dough 3 inches (8 cm) apart from one another on a parchment paper-lined baking sheet. Bake in a preheated oven for 12-14 minutes. Let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for 2-3 minutes before transferring to a cooling rack to cool completely. Enjoy!

Pro tip experiment with your butter temp. I like a crispy cookie with a chewy center so I chill my brown butter until solid. Fully melted butter is gonna give you two options. Bake right away and they're thinner and crispier, chill and bake from cold and they're softer and chewy. Baking is an art and a science, every change can yield a totally different cookie.

Here’s the full recipe for anyone wondering Ingredients for 12 cookies ½ cup granulated sugar ¾ cup brown sugar, packed 1 teaspoon salt ½ cup unsalted butter, melted 1 egg 1 teaspoon vanilla extract 1 ¼ cups all-purpose flour ½ teaspoon baking soda 4 oz milk or semi-sweet chocolate chunks 4 oz dark chocolate chunk, or your preference Preparation In a large bowl, whisk together the sugars, salt, and butter until a paste forms with no lumps. Whisk in the egg and vanilla, beating until light ribbons fall off the whisk and remain for a short while before falling back into the mixture. Sift in the flour and baking soda, then fold the mixture with a spatula (Be careful not to overmix, which would cause the gluten in the flour to toughen resulting in cakier cookies). Fold in the chocolate chunks, then chill the dough for at least 30 minutes. For a more intense toffee-like flavor and deeper color, chill the dough overnight. The longer the dough rests, the more complex its flavor will be.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Scoop the dough with an ice-cream scoop onto a parchment paper-lined baking sheet, leaving at least 4 inches (10 cm) of space between cookies and 2 inches (5 cm) of space from the edges of the pan so that the cookies can spread evenly.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the edges have started to barely brown. Cool completely before serving. Enjoy!
